Summary QuEra Computing, Inc. seeks a creative and collaborative Scientific Software Engineer to help solve the unique software challenges of integrating high-level applications into state-of-the-art neutral-atom quantum computers. You will have the opportunity to work with a vibrant scientific software team and a community of industry and academic collaborators and to help our growing team of diverse experts address fascinating challenges, ranging from classical compiler techniques to direct integration with low-level hardware components. Using our open-source toolchain, Kirin, you will be building QuEra’s compiler pipeline together with experimental computational physicists from low-level hardware instructions to high-level programming languages. This involves the development of new features and infrastructure for hardware execution. You will be co-designing compilers and hardware infrastructure for the next generation of quantum computing using cutting-edge neutral-atom and quantum error correction technologies. This emerging direction involves novel challenges in both engineering and science. In this Japan-based role, you will focus on movement/shuttling-aware compilation and optimization and support engagement of users of QuEra’s Gemini-class neutral-atom system integrated into AIST’s ABCIQ hybrid quantum-classical computing environment. Responsibilities Develop and maintain compiler components and APIs for atom shuttling / movement-aware compilation , contributing directly to Bloqade Shuttle and Bloqade Lanes . Implement and improve optimization methods relevant to shuttling workflows (e.g., routing/scheduling/planning heuristics, constraint-aware transformations, and cost-model-driven compilation decisions). Collaborate with scientists and hardware/control teams to translate experimental constraints into robust compiler abstractions and execution-ready instruction streams (including shuttling and related low-level features). Provide customer and collaborator support in Japan , including issue triage, reproducing bugs, delivering fixes, and supporting integration/operations for the ABCIQ / AIST deployment. Uphold strong engineering practices in public repos: code review, CI/testing, release hygiene, and thoughtful API evolution. Qualifications Ph.D. in Computer Science, Physics, Applied Mathematics, or a related field, or equivalent professional experience. Strong software engineering skills in Python (type hints, testing, packaging, tooling), and comfort working across a scientific codebase. Experience with at least one of: optimization , graph algorithms , routing/scheduling , path planning , or related algorithmic areas. Ability to collaborate effectively across disciplines (software, AMO/experimental physics, hardware/control, applications). Fluent in Japanese and English for technical communication with customers and the global team. Demonstrable experience contributing to open-source projects on GitHub (PRs, reviews, issue-driven development). Preferred Qualifications Background in AMO physics and/or neutral-atom quantum computing concepts relevant to shuttling and gate-model execution. Experience with compiler infrastructure (IR design, SSA-based approaches, LLVM/MLIR-style concepts) or DSL/eDSL development. Experience with Rust in addition to Python. Familiarity with quantum error correction workflows and hardware/software co-design in hybrid quantum-classical settings.
